msys2 pacman的下载问题

时间:2016-08-31 10:40:09

标签: curl proxy msys

我正在尝试按照here设置msys2。当我执行第5步以运行" pacman -Sy pacman"时,它会报告

error: failed retrieving file 'mingw32.db' from repo.msys2.org : The requested URL returned error: 403
error: failed retrieving file 'mingw32.db' from downloads.sourceforge.net : The requested URL returned error: 403
error: failed retrieving file 'mingw32.db' from www2.futureware.at : The requested URL returned error: 403

我在带有经过身份验证的代理的网络下运行此功能,我已经在运行" pacman"之前配置了here提到的代理设置。命令。

在同一个shell中,我运行了#34; pacman"使用--debug选项获取" mingw32.db"的URL并尝试使用" curl"手动下载如

 curl -O http://repo.msys2.org/mingw/i686/mingw32.db

这可以下载该文件。所以我假设我的代理设置在msys2 shell中没问题。

我不确定为什么" pacman"由于内部使用" curl"。

,因此无法自行下载文件

这里有什么错误吗?

2 个答案:

答案 0 :(得分:0)

/etc/pacman.conf 文件中,取消注释第18行或第19行,以使用 curl wget

XferCommand = /usr/bin/wget --passive-ftp -c -O %o %u

退出并重启shell。现在可以访问回购。

Source

答案 1 :(得分:0)

我有类似的问题。 export default connect(mapStateToProps,mapDispatchToProps)(Component); curl包不起作用,但是mys2版本没有。

mingw